How can businesses effectively integrate customer feedback into their decision-making processes to ensure a truly customer-centric approach, and what strategies can be implemented to consistently exceed customer expectations?
Businesses can effectively integrate customer feedback into their decision-making processes by actively listening to customer suggestions, complaints, and preferences. This can be done through surveys, feedback forms, social media monitoring, and direct communication channels. To ensure a truly customer-centric approach, businesses can analyze and prioritize feedback based on frequency, severity, and impact on customer satisfaction. Strategies such as personalized customer experiences, continuous improvement based on feedback, proactive communication, and swift resolution of customer issues can help consistently exceed customer expectations and build long-term loyalty.
